Juan Pablo, did win last week. It was his first Nextel Cup win. The were racing out in Sonoma California at a road course. He has yet to win at an oval, but I imagine that it is just a matter of time. He is a good racer, he just has to get used to driving a bigger, heavier car. Some of these drivers describe the difference in driving a stock car and an F1 or Indy car as driving a dump truck instead of a Porsche.
